Tommywas adapted from The Who ’s classic album of the same name , which recount the dramatic journey of a deaf , slow and blind kidskin who ’s revealed to be a pinball virtuoso and afterwards a spiritual messiah of variety . Ken Russell , director ofThe DevilsandAltered States , signed on to direct the movie variation , despite his dislike of stone music . The Who ’s Roger Daltrey plays the title fictional character inTommy , while the supporting cast let in Jack Nicholson ( Batman ) , Oliver Reed , Tina Turner , and Ann Margeret .

Ann Margeret - who recently appear in SYFY’sHappy!- plays Tommy ’s female parent Nora and her powerful performance scored her an Academy Award nomination for Best Actress . Tommyis a movie loaded with psychedelic look-alike and sequences , which includes the noted moment where Nora hallucinate a television receiver throw up soap lather on her , followed by baked beans and chocolate . Margeret ’s commitment to Nora ’s nervous breakdown in this scenery and terpsichore while covered in gallons of beans and chocolate make it a toilsome scenery to forget , and the actress had to be taken to hospital during filming after cut herself on broken glass .

This scene fromTommyis an court toThe Who trade Out , the band ’s record album which features a bunch of simulated adverts , and a cover where Daltry is bathing in parched noodle . The shot was also revenge on the part of Ken Russell , who directed legion commercials early in his career - including for edible bean and detergent - with the sequence playing like a crazed ad itself .
